About Our Team

The Knowledge Graph (KG) team at eBay plays a pivotal role in eBay's core business, spanning various application domains such as search retrieval, recommendation, and selling. Our team comprises experts in applied research, data, and software engineering, fostering a culture of rapid innovation with no shortage of challenges for motivated individuals.

Position: Applied Researcher

Responsibilities

  • Develop machine learning models and data pipelines to construct Knowledge Graphs, annotate KG entities and intents to enrich search queries, and inventory contents
  • Build and support applications to enhance search retrieval, recommendation, relevance and ranking
  • Collaborate with operations team to ensure the quality of any human-labeled data required
  • Carefully measure your output and impact in order to learn and improve over time
  • Help define and refine project scopes, goals, and metrics
  • Engage with the eBay Science community promote standard scientific methodologies and processes in your field


Requirements

  • MS/PhD in Computer Science, Statistics, Mathematics, or equivalent field
  • Strong programming skills in Java and Python
  • Experience with one or more of the following: classification, regression, NLP, clustering, Deep Learning / Neural Networks
  • Experience in Big Data processing frameworks, e.g. Hadoop, Hive, Spark
  • Experience in Knowledge Graph technology stack is a plus
  • Ability to adapt to emerging challenges and execute under ambiguity.
  • Strong interpersonal skills and an appreciation for diversity in teamwork
